Bacvice City Beach is Split's most popular sandy beach, offering a vibrant atmosphere with crystal-clear waters, perfect for sunbathing, swimming, and socializing. Located in the heart of the city, it boasts numerous amenities and is a favorite among locals and tourists alike.
